The position: The Property Accounting Analyst will be responsible for supporting the reporting and analytical goals as it relates to the Property Accounting function. The focal point for this position is to review financial packages to identify areas of improvement, and gather information to help identify, track, and report key performance indicators for the Property Accounting Team.

 

 

 

Responsibilities

  • Assist in the development and implementation of the property accounting's reporting/analytics team goals including identifying key focal areas and efficient strategies to collect accurate data
  • Maintain current and accurate reporting/analysis checklists, complete assigned tasks on time, and communicate reason for any delays
  • Review monthly financial reporting packages and document deviations from standard policies and procedures
  • Collaborate with the Property Accounting Team to fully understand the reason for deviations from standard policies and procedures
  • Prepare analytical reporting by collecting, analyzing, and summarizing financial information and key performance indicators to effectively and accurately report results and identify trends
  • Other responsibilities as assigned to help support department and team goals

Qualifications

Education &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ance or equivalent experience
  • 3+ Years of Property Management Accounting Experience
  • Excellent written and verbal commun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work independently and prioritize effectively in a fast-paced environment
  • Advanced Excel skills for financial analysis and reporting
  • Tableau and Salesforce experience preferred
  • Preferred Industry Specific Software: Yardi, RealPage/Onesite, Entrata
